Exercise Referral

Exercise referral is aimed at individuals who are not used to regular exercise, or who are recovering from, or dealing with, a health issue. After referral by a health professional, a co-ordinator discusses the reasons for referral and develops a programme to match their aims and abilities.

This service is available at local leisure centres in Mid Sussex.
